Swiss-Bacon Spinach Tartlets |
|
 |
Prep Time: 25 Minutes Cook Time: 15 Minutes |
Ready In: 40 Minutes Servings: 15 |
|
I developed this recipe as a way to entice my husband to eat spinach. When I first made the tarts for Christmas, they disappeared within minutes. Guests were surprised when I told them the key ingredient!Kimberly Carr, Akron, Ohio Ingredients:
1/2 pound sliced bacon, diced |
2/3 cup chopped sweet onion |
1 garlic clove, minced |
1 package (10 ounces) frozen chopped spinach, thawed and squeezed dry |
2 tablespoons sugar |
1 teaspoon worcestershire sauce |
1/2 teaspoon salt |
1/2 teaspoon pepper |
1/2 teaspoon liquid smoke, optional |
1 package (1.9 ounces) frozen miniature phyllo tart shells |
2/3 cup shredded swiss cheese |
Directions:
1. In large skillet over medium heat, cook bacon until crisp. Remove to paper towels; drain, reserving 1 tablespoon drippings. Saute onion and garlic in drippings until tender. 2. Reduce heat to medium. Stir in the spinach, sugar, Worcestershire sauce, salt, pepper and Liquid Smoke if desired; heat through. Stir in the bacon. 3. In each tart shell, layer 1 teaspoon of Swiss cheese, 1 tablespoon of spinach mixture and another teaspoon of cheese. Place on an ungreased baking sheet. 4. Bake at 350° for 12-15 minutes or until cheese is melted. Serve warm. Refrigerate leftovers. Yield: 15 appetizers. |
